Wichita
Wichita stands as a major logistics and manufacturing center in the Midwest, earning its reputation as the 'Air Capital of the World' through its aerospace industry concentration. The city's central location provides strategic access to major freight routes across the United States. Wichita's economy is anchored by aviation manufacturing, with companies like Boeing, Cessna, and Learjet maintaining significant operations. The city's transportation infrastructure includes extensive highway networks, rail connections, and proximity to major air cargo facilities, supporting efficient distribution throughout the central United States.
